Terminal Bar - Gritty NYC Bar Documentary


Terminal Bar, Stefan Nadelman (2003) from reinadafrica on Vimeo.

From Gil:
Just flipping through some Vimeo stuff I came across one of my all-time favorite short films. This is an unbelievably well-made documentary about a gritty NYC bar seen through thousands of black and white photographs that a bartender took of the patrons. It's a testament to how dynamic something can be when edited and composited really well. Considering that it consists mostly of still images it's amazing:

MegaShark - DEATH IN THE SKIES! (infographic)

Has anyone seen this?:

From the "worstest" movie ever made! Seriously, being the stupid movies lover that I am, I had to watch Mega Shark vs. Giant Octopus (don't judge! It had Sharks fighting Octopuses... staring the best teeny-bop singer turned actress: Deborah Gibson!! Seriously, how can you turn away?).

The internets were abuzz over that show stopping scene! In fact, they created an infographic over the staggering physics needed for a MEGA shark to LEAP into the air with enough force to SNATCH and EAT an unsuspecting passenger airplane - OUT OF THE AIR!!! Apparently Mr. Mega Shark had to be traveling at 702 Mph to complete that feat!
